'C.A.B. (Catch A Body) (feat. Fivio Foreign)

Chris Brown Chris Brown

A Night of Indulgence and Liberation

Chris Brown's 'C.A.B. (Catch A Body) (feat. Fivio Foreign)' is a vivid portrayal of a night filled with hedonistic pleasures and unrestrained freedom. The song's lyrics paint a picture of a lavish party atmosphere where the protagonist is fully immersed in the moment, enjoying the high life and the company of a woman who is equally ready to indulge. The recurring theme of 'catching a body' is a metaphor for engaging in a passionate, fleeting encounter, emphasizing the transient nature of the night's experiences.

The song delves into themes of escapism and the pursuit of pleasure. The references to luxury, such as being 'iced out for the party' and traveling to exotic locations like Dubai, highlight a lifestyle that is both glamorous and detached from everyday reality. The protagonist's interactions with the woman, who is described as having a 'dragon tatt' and performing 'a couple things I didn't know,' suggest a sense of discovery and excitement. This is further amplified by the repeated assertion that he is 'on go,' ready to embrace whatever the night brings without any reservations.

Fivio Foreign's verse adds a layer of complexity to the narrative, introducing elements of danger and unpredictability. His lines about seeing a 'opp' and the gun flashing in the light, as well as the mention of being a 'demon,' juxtapose the party's carefree vibe with a hint of menace. This duality reflects the unpredictable nature of nightlife, where moments of joy can quickly turn into something more intense. The song ultimately captures the essence of living in the moment, where the pursuit of pleasure and the thrill of the unknown take center stage.
